Favorites gone mad...
I’ll try to explain this as precisely as I can so you don’t need to waste your time asking me further questions.
I have windows 7 Ultimate.
I have a desktop shortcut to Favorites.
To my knowledge, I have changed nothing recently.
I have run multiple AV & Malware scans that all come back clean.
Here’s the problem:
Anything I try to move within the main Favorites (only favorites) folder generates a yellow “Windows Security Warning” that says in part “These Files May be Harmful…” I’m sure you have all seen them before.
Now, this only happens within the main folder, not in subfolders within Favorites.
It is not limited to Internet shortcuts either.
I can open a new word doc in Favorites and as soon as I try to move it within or to the desktop, I get the “Warning.” I can move anything from outside the Favorites into it without the warning but if I try to move that same item back out I get the warning. I have read old Google items but they all refer to it being a Local Intranet issue. I don’t think so.
